Benefits of Rooftop Tents
One of the main advantages of rooftop tents is their convenience. Instead of dealing with the hassle of setting up and taking down a traditional tent, rooftop tents can be quickly deployed and packed away with minimal effort. This is especially beneficial for those who like to move around frequently on their camping trips or want to save time on the setup process.
Furthermore, rooftop tents provide an elevated sleeping platform, keeping you safe from uneven or wet ground. Not only does this offer a more comfortable sleeping experience, but it also provides added security from wildlife or potential intruders. Additionally, being raised off the ground can help with airflow and ventilation, ensuring a more pleasant sleeping environment.
Another benefit of rooftop tents is their versatility. Whether you’re camping in the mountains, desert, or beach, rooftop tents can easily adapt to different terrains and weather conditions. Their durable construction and weatherproof materials make them suitable for year-round use, providing protection from rain, wind, and sun exposure.
Choosing the Right Rooftop Tent
When it comes to choosing a rooftop tent, there are several factors to consider to ensure you find the perfect one for your needs. Here are some key features to keep in mind:
1. Size: Rooftop tents come in a variety of sizes, from solo tents to family-sized models. Consider how many people will be using the tent and the amount of space you need for sleeping comfortably.
2. Installation: Some rooftop tents require mounting hardware or a roof rack for installation, while others are designed to be universal and can be attached to any car roof. Make sure to choose a tent that is compatible with your vehicle and installation preferences.
3. Material: Look for tents made from durable and waterproof materials such as ripstop nylon or polyester. Quality materials will ensure your tent holds up well in different weather conditions and lasts for years to come.
4. Features: Consider additional features like built-in mattresses, windows, awnings, and storage pockets. These extras can enhance your camping experience and provide added convenience during your trip.
5. Brand Reputation: Research different brands and read reviews from other campers to ensure you are purchasing a reliable and high-quality rooftop tent. Brands like Tepui, Roofnest, and Yakima are well-known for their durable and innovative designs.
